Transaction 51a2740ab4fe744cc76e5662a0c5dee16bc79d9da160a9e36313ca6103160293

1 Input
2 Outputs
  • 51a2740ab4fe744cc76e5662a0c5dee16bc79d9da160a9e36313ca6103160293:0
  • value  5788970
    address  3BjE3F9ymPAezknkjVsCtExp7zZeV49sm5
  • 51a2740ab4fe744cc76e5662a0c5dee16bc79d9da160a9e36313ca6103160293:1
  • value  707100
    address  3CnS2THKd9m6AS4VTPQDgcKhDaQwhYn7Xw